School of Life Sciences
The School of Life Sciences prides itself on providing a friendly and supportive learning environment. There are rigorous teaching programmes in Biological Sciences, Sport and Exercise Science and in Applied Psychology. The School also includes the International Centre for Brewing and Distilling, and the Centre for Marine Biodiversity and Biotechnology.
